Carlos Rodimiro Lucero Paz
Carlos Rodimiro Lucero Paz is a prominent Guatemalan jurist who currently serves as the vocal I of the Corte Suprema de Justicia (CSJ). Elected with a significant majority of votes, he is positioned to assume the presidency of the CSJ if no agreement is reached among the magistrates for the upcoming election. His role is crucial as he will also chair the commission responsible for selecting the next fiscal general, a key position in the Guatemalan judicial system.
